What is a contingent offer, and does it hurt my chances of getting a home?

By Todd SpencerFrom: Selling and Buying at the Same Time in New Braunfels: How to Time It RightLast updated:

Quick answer

A contingent offer makes your purchase dependent on your current home selling by a certain date. It does typically weaken your offer compared to a non-contingent buyer, since sellers generally prefer certainty — in a competitive situation, a seller may choose a lower non-contingent offer over a higher contingent one.
